Printer Section
3. button
Specifies advanced printer settings and options.
<Printer Features>
• Sort
Select whether to Stack or Sort when printing multiple copies.
Note: Paper must be loaded into the machine in both directions when using the Rotate Stack and
Rotate Sort functions (i.e. Letter and Letter-R, A4 and A4-R).
• Toner Save (For DP-180/190 only)
This setting saves toner by reducing its consumption, and it is cost-effective when printing many draft
copies prior to the final document.
• Secure
Select Mailbox or Secure Mailbox if storing the print data into the mailbox of the machine. Available if the
optional Hard Disk Drive Unit (DA-HD18/HD19/HD30/HD60) is installed.
Note: 1. The PS Driver Security Utility must be installed in order to use the user ID password.
2. DA-HD18: For DP1520P/1820P/1820E; DA-HD19: For DP-180/190;
DA-HD30: For DP-2330/3030; DA-HD60: For DP-3530/4530/6030.
• Print Blank Pages
Select whether the blank pages are printed or not.
• Tray Switching (For DP-2330/3030/3530/4530/6030 only)
For uninterrupted printing, this setting allows automatic tray switching to another tray with same paper
size, when the paper runs out of selected tray.
• Front Cover Page
Select to insert a blank page as a Front Cover. Specify where the paper you want to use is located in the
device. If you choose Auto Tray Selection, the printer driver will automatically select an appropriate tray
according to the Paper Size selected.
• Back Cover Page
Select to insert a blank page as a Back Cover. Specify where the paper you want to use is located in the
device. If you choose Auto Tray Selection, the printer driver will automatically select an appropriate tray
according to the Paper Size selected.
